Listed below is a recommended schedule of well child exam visits. Other mental and physical developmental tests are available if there is a need. Our pediatricians will also ask about family medical history to determine if any hereditary medical concerns are present. Your baby or child’s well child visit will include a physical examination (height, weight, hearing, vision, blood pressure and heart rate) to check for health problems and prevent any future problems by assessing risk. It is important to monitor both of these forms of development. The mental and physical development of your child in their youth is a fairly quick process. The sooner medical conditions are found during your child’s development, the greater chance there is to properly diagnose, treat and even prevent certain conditions. Visits allow pediatricians to assess and analyze development comprehensively. Health problems and developmental conditions may not be apparent during your child’s development. As your child gets older, well child visits are recommended on an annual basis. During the early stages of your child’s life many different body systems are being developed and well child visits are recommended on a more frequent basis to assess development. The proper development of your child is important to their health for the rest of their life.
